Think Carefully Before Redecorating Your Kitchen!

By far the kitchen is one of the most important rooms in the home. It has grown in importance from an out-of-the-way service area to a room that's central both physically and functionally to the home, which is why kitchen decorating ideas are so important.

Kitchen decorating ideas are easy to find if you know where to look and keep a more observant eye open. Channels like the Home and Garden Television Network and the Discovery Channel have paved the way for many homeowners’ home improvement renovations. Among the renovations are kitchen makeovers that incorporate state of the art kitchen decorating ideas as well as traditional styles and decorating ideas. There are even specials on do-it-yourself kitchen decorating ideas that can teach you simple things like wall-painting jobs, such as sponging, mottling, and rag-rolling that can make your kitchen a tad more attractive. You can even get ideas by really noticing the kitchens in various homes that you visit like your friends’ and relatives’ homes.

Perhaps one of the most difficult things is deciding whether you want to go retro or whether you want the trendiest cooking space available on the market today. What can make this decision harder is if you live in a home that’s generally traditional and everything in your floor plan caters for a traditional kitchen. But the good news is that if you do choose to stick with the traditional style kitchen décor you can always update the look to keep your kitchen looking new, fresh and working functionally. Again all you have to do is look around. Try visiting your local home improvement store and have a chat with the sales assistants or even jump online and browse the internet for some great ideas in the traditional department.

However it can sometimes be easier to find kitchen decorating ideas for modern cooking areas than it is for retro-style rooms and also many people prefer to really upgrade instead of just update their kitchens and for these reasons a lot of people tend to opt for the contemporary style kitchen décor. There are many sleek contemporary kitchen decorating ideas available on the market today so finding one that’s right for your needs, budget and available kitchen space shouldn’t prove too difficult. The beauty of contemporary kitchen designs really lies in its sleek and smooth designs that allow you to hide every appliance behind cabinets that boast clean lines and smooth edges. These appliances can be recessed into the walls or they can be built right into your countertops and the look is not only elegantly subtle, but it also works great in saving a lot of space in your kitchen.

However because the entire face of kitchen décor has changed to be more space, time and money economic, many of today’s appliances are designed to camouflage themselves into the room. These concealed models function on a superior level than the customary appliances and come in such a vast array that they can match and mesh well with almost any existing kitchen décor.
Adding accent kitchen lighting is yet another way to really give your kitchen a nice face lift and it can be done very cheaply and quickly. Cabinet and counter lighting are good options for a quick functional and aesthetic look.

But whatever decorating idea you choose to employ in your kitchen it is always best that your décor works for you instead of against you. Functionality should never be compromised for beauty especially not in a kitchen. It’s a wise idea for your kitchen decorating ideas to suit your dining room and living room needs as well since these rooms tend to directly correspond with each other.
